Output afc90c01ea7a1c60a4d7becbed30ab2e22a21d2bc22f7a4f48cb085147d8c822:35

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db877b05985ddb32d6201214f8c843ce27845cdf7a3dd5f4259ca557a3cb66f3
address
bc1pmwrhkpvcthdn943qzg203jzrecncghxl0g7atap9njj40g7tvmes5l82da
transaction
afc90c01ea7a1c60a4d7becbed30ab2e22a21d2bc22f7a4f48cb085147d8c822